11/23/24 | Seattle Mariners Sign Veteran Reliever Yunior Marte to Minor League Deal. The Seattle Mariners major league roster has three open roster spots after Friday's tender deadline with clear needs in the infield and the bullpen. Over 30 prospects have left the Mariners farm system via free agency or retirement this offseason. Seattle has already gone to work this offseason rebuilding pitching depth to its farm system. The organization brought back veteran arms Jesse Hahn and Casey Lawrence, and signed former Philadelphia Phillies and New York Mets prospect Adonis Medina to a minor league deal with a spring training invite.
